The number of people killed in gun shootings each year varies by country and region. In the United States, for example,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) reported over 45,000 gun-related deaths in 2020, including homicides and suicides. Globally, the World Health Organization estimates that around 250,000 people die from gun violence annually. However, these figures can fluctuate based on various factors, including legislation, social conditions, and conflict.
